Chile: Tree Nuts Annual

  |   Attaché Report (GAIN)

Due to the presence of the El Niño current this year, rains were close to normal levels throughout Chile. The increase in rain provides necessary irrigation of Chile’s tree nut sector, which positively contributes to its increasing production. If the climatic conditions are maintained during the spring, walnut production is expected to increase by as much as ten percent and almonds are expected to reach historical levels.
